RHOSYNFA is a small extended semi-detached house of 89m², built sometime between 1930 and 1949. It was last sold for £155,000 in August 2016, which was around 11% above the average August 2016 semi-detached price in the Conwy local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was June 2010,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

RHOSYNFA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Conwy local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five RHOSYNFA sales between March 1998 and August 2016 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the April 2007 sale was for 6%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 6% above the HPI over time, until the August 2016 sale, where it rises to 11%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 11% above the HPI.

RHOSYNFA: Plot and Title Map

RHOSYNFA sits on a plot of roughly 0.062 of an acre, or 252m². The below map shows the location of RHOSYNFA,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of RHOSYNFA).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
